UI for "browser-specific" API list is pretty much unusable #482

STEPS TO REPRODUCE:

  1. Load https://web-confluence.appspot.com/#!/confluence
  2. Click the "Browser-specific" tab (I don't see a way to link to that directly).
  3. Click a point on the graph (e.g. the last one for Firefox).
  4. Click the little box-with-an-arrow icon to get to the relevant API list. It's a long url.

EXPECTED RESULTS: Can look through the list to see what the APIs are

ACTUAL RESULTS: All the columns, including the API column, are really narrow, so it's impossible to see what the APIs are. Trying to close any of the other columns doesn't work, because hovering over them expands the name in the header, moving the "x", and trying to then move to the "x" re-collapses the header, so I can never click on the "x".
